説明 | Australia. BMC's small car was the Mini. The original Mini featured an 848cc transversely mounted engine, front wheel drive, ten inch wheels and independent suspensionJohn Cooper, saw the potential in a motorsports version; The Mini Cooper; introduced in 1961 featured a racing-tuned 997cc engine, twin SU carburettors, closer-ratio gearbox and front disc brakes. They got the Super Deluxe overriders and chrome trim around the windows.The further improved 1963 Cooper S got the larger 1071cc tuned engine, (then 1275cc in 1964) race suspension and better brakes. This car is an ex works rally car, built by the BMC Competitions Dept, first raced in the 1967 European Rally Championship by Rauno Aaltonen and later in the year brought to Australia to compete there by Paddy Hopkirk in the 1967 Southern Cross Rally. Tony Fall, Evan Green and Colin Bond also competed in the car |
